Flooring Replacement After Water Damage v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Minor water spill, less than 100 sq. Ft. | Yes | No | You can handle minor spills with basic cleaning supplies. |
| Major water flood, over 100 sq. Ft. | No | Yes | Large areas need specialized equipment and expertise to dry and replace flooring. |
| Water damage to multiple rooms. | No | Yes | Multi-room water damage needs a comprehensive plan to dry and replace flooring in each room. |
| High-risk areas, such as bedrooms or bathrooms. | No | Yes | High-risk areas need specialized care to prevent mold growth and ensure safety. |
| Water damage to subfloor or foundation. | No | Yes | Subfloor or foundation damage needs specialized expertise to repair and prevent further damage. |
| Water damage to hardwood or tile flooring. | No | Yes | Water damage to hardwood or tile flooring needs specialized care to prevent damage and ensure a proper repair. |
If you’re unsure about whether to DIY or call a professional, err on the side of caution. Water damage can be unpredictable, and improper handling can lead to bigger problems down the line. Flooring Replacement After Water Damage Cost In Scottsdale, AZ
The cost of flooring replacement after water damage can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Scottsdale, AZ. Our team will provide a free estimate after assessing the damage to give you a more accurate quote.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water removal and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ed. |
| Flooring removal and replacement |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of flooring, and subfloor condition. |
| Subfloor repair or replacement | $1,500 – $10,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, and type of subfloor material. |
| Inspection and assessment |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area and complexity of damage. |
| Permit fees and inspections | $100 – $1,000 | Local regulations and jurisdictional requirements. |
| Debris removal and disposal |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area and type of debris. |
